I do have a lovely Beetroot and Orange and ginger soup recipe that I'll try to dig out. This last week I made a curried carrot and lentil soup. Tomorrow I'm nakjing carrot and ginger soup i think .

Curried carrot soup

Sauté some crushed or chopped garlic and some fresh ginger in some olive oil.

Add a chopped onion and cook til softened.

Add curry powder to taste - I used 1 1/2 teaspoons of medium. let this cook through for a couple of minutes.

Add 3 or 4 chopped carrots

Add a litre of veg stock

Add dried red lentils and bring to the boil, put a lid on the pan and reduce to a simmer - cook til lentils cooked though (ones i used said 30 minutes)

Blend when cool and season.

Made enough for my lunches for the week.
